I have to introduce my first soft toy. I made him with a pattern of a magazine. He is a tricky one. He is a bunny, but can hide and then he seems an egg. It is very good, as he is a bit shy...(He was very kind to let me take this picture about him)
He is absolutely handmade... It was a big project for me that time, as I have never tried to make soft toys before.... In fact the only difficult part is the fabric. I used plush for him, which I got from my mother-in-law. I had small pieces only but that is a good thing about patchwork, you can use everything, even really very small pieces....
His eyes are made of beads and he is filled with lentil (or something like lentil...).
